Rapid City Stevens 7, Brookings 1

RAPID CITY — Brady Waddell struck out nine batters as Rapid City Stevens swept Brookings in game two of super regional action on Saturday. RC Stevens will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23

Waddell allowed just one run on four hits and three walks in six innings, striking out nine in the win.

Bridger Mez drove in two runs on two doubles, Liam Unterbrunner had three hits and an RBI, Karter Brager and Trevor Schlosser each drove in a run on two hits while Tucker Waddell and Conor Konvalin each had an RBI in the win.

For Brookings, Noah Lease allowed seven runs on 12 hits and a walk in 6.1 innings, striking out three.

Jase Bauer had two hits and a walk while Ben Schulte collected an RBI on one hit in the loss.


Pierre 6, Mitchell 2

PIERRE — Will Danburg tallied six strong innings on the mound to power Pierre over Mitchell in game two of super regional action on Saturday. Pierre will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23.

Danburg allowed two runs on four hits and two walks in six innings, striking out one in the win.

Parker O’Bryan drove in two runs on a walk, Tripp Lindekugel added an RBI on a walk while Porter Hunsley had an RBI on a hit and a walk in the win.

For Mitchell, Carter McCormick allowed four unearned runs on one hit and six walks, striking out seven in six innings.

Stratton Forst had the lone RBI in the loss for the Kernels.


Sioux Falls Jefferson 14, Spearfish 2 (6 innings)

SIOUX FALLS — Caleb Goodroach drove in five runs as Sioux Falls Jefferson swept Spearfish in super regional action on Saturday. Jefferson will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23.

Goodroach had five RBIs on a double and a walk in the win, Noah Grabow added two RBIs on one hit, Boston Bryant had an RBI on two walks, Noah Kuenzi recorded two hits, a walk and an RBI, Brody Jacobson recorded three hits while Easton Riley and Maddox Zens each had an RBI on a hit and a walk in the win.

Everett Salonen took the win on the mound in five innings of work, allowing two runs on one hit and four walks, striking out six.

For Spearfish, Walker Viessman allowed eight runs on eight hits and two walks in five innings in the loss.

Bray Bowar had an RBI for the Spartans.


Watertown 6, Sioux Falls Lincoln 1

WATERTOWN — Jackson McClemans tossed 6.1 strong innings as Watertown swept Sioux Falls Lincoln in super regional action on Saturday. Watertown will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23.

McClemans allowed just one run on nine hits and a walk in 6.1 innings, striking out six in the win.

Carter Buisker, Sam Olson, Ashton Rabine and Maxx Sears each had an RBI on a hit while Markus Pitkin had three hits in the win.

For Lincoln, Owen Lechtenberg took the loss in five innings, allowing five runs on six hits and five walks, striking out two.

Opland Sonnichsen had three hits and an RBI while Jude Timat and Jacksyn Raak each had two hits in the loss.


Brandon Valley 17, Sioux Falls Washington 3

BRANDON — Jack Blomgren drove in six runs as Brandon Valley swept Sioux Falls Washington in super regional action on Saturday. Brandon Valley will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23.

Blomgren batted 3-for-5 with a homer and six RBIs, Grady Gindorff added two hits, a homer and a walk, with four RBIs, Mason Veld had two hits, a homer and a walk with two RBIs, Bryce Plucker tallied two RBIs on a homer and a walk, Brayden Knutson and Caleb Severin each drove in a run on one hit while Bryton Stroh recorded two hits and two walks in the win.

Taylor Melby took the win on the mound in five innings, allowing three runs on three hits and two walks, striking out 10 in the win.

For Washington, Tyler Ringheimer allowed six runs on seven hits in two innings, striking out one in the loss.

Easton Pearson had two hits and an RBI while Kylar White drove in two runs on a homer and a walk in the loss.


O’Gorman 10, Sioux Falls Roosevelt 1

SIOUX FALLS — O’Gorman dominated in game two to sweep Sioux Falls Roosevelt in super regional action on Saturday. O’Gorman will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23.

Alex McKinney had three RBIs on two hits and a walk, Bennett Duncan added two RBIs on two hits, a double, and a walk, Joey Laible tallied two RBIs on a double, Gavin Hammrich had an RBI on two hits and a walk, Paxton Sohn drew an RBI-walk while Sam Donohoe had an RBI on a double and a walk in the win.

Landon Nohrenberg took the win on the mound in four innings, allowing one run on four hits and four walks, striking out five.

For Roosevelt, Dylan Kreich allowed six runs on six hits and five walks in five innings of work, striking out four.

Austin Cargin had two hits while Lawsen Hensley tallied an RBI-single in the loss.


Yankton 16, Sturgis Brown 0 (5 innings)

YANKTON — Yankton exploded for 12 hits and 10 walks to sweep Sturgis Brown in super regional action on Saturday. Yankton will play in the Class A state tournament May 22-23.

Simon Kampshoff had three hits, a double, and two RBIs for the Bucks, Jackson Kudera added three RBIs on two hits, Liam Villanueva tallied two RBIs on two hits, a double and a walk, Easton Feser had two RBIs on a triple and two walks, Beck Ryken had an RBI on two doubles and a walk, Samuel Gokie totaled an RBI on a double and a walk while Tate Beste and Carter Boomsma each had an RBI on a combined three walks in the win.

Gokie took the win on the mound in four shutout innings, allowing three hits while striking out four.

For SB, Brody Royer allowed eight runs on seven hits and five walks in 2.1 innings in the loss.

Bridger Massa-Battin, Elijah Stroud, Ethan Cermak and Jack Jolley each tallied hits in the loss for SB.
